Copyright is the legal right granted to an author, a composer, a playwright, a publisher, or a
distributor to exclusive publication, prodruction, sale, or distribution of a literary, musical, dramatic,
or artistic work.

In Education
0Section II0 of copyright law allows public education to display or perform copyrighted material as long as it occurs during face-to-face teaching, the material has been lawfully obtained, and there is no profit being made
0When working on a research you must either be fair or you must have permission. Also, be sure to always cite materials you do use appropriately.
